Abstract
Background. Adherence to ethical norms is a fundamental condition for the existence of science as a social institution. Research ethics encompasses the application of moral principles to all stages of scientific research, while publishing ethics ensures the independence of editorial decisions.
Aim. To develop editorial policies of scientific periodicals of Kharkiv National Medical University in the field of research ethics and publishing ethics.
Materials and Methods. To achieve this goal, systemic analysis, bibliosemantic and comparative methods were used. The research materials included international guidelines PEMS, DORA, COPE, WAME, ICMJE, CONSORT, as well as the editorial policy of Elsevier publishing house.
Research Ethics. The results of the study were approved by the Ethical Commission of Kharkiv National Medical University (Protocol No. 6 of June 4, 2025). All necessary references to literary sources are provided.
Results. The developed editorial policies of the journals "Medicine Today and Tomorrow", "Experimental and Clinical Medicine" and "Inter Collegas" regulate in detail the principles of editorial work, authorship and author contribution, complaints and appeals procedure, conflict of interest policy, data sharing and reproducibility policy, ethical oversight, intellectual property use, post-publication discussions, corrections and retractions of articles, combating plagiarism, citation manipulation, data falsification and fabrication, as well as the use of artificial intelligence and advertising policy.
Conclusions. The developed editorial policies of the journals of Kharkiv National Medical University generally comply with international standards of research and publishing ethics. Further improvement requires a mechanism for monitoring compliance with these rules and raising awareness of the scientific community about the consequences of ethical violations.
Keywords: academic integrity, editorial policy, conflict of interest, plagiarism, retraction, artificial intelligence.
